Criminology is the 80th most popular major in the country with 11,039 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, criminology gra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$33,568 and had an average of $24,453 in loans still to pay off.
Across New Mexico, there were 83 criminology graduates with average earnings and debt of $26,068 and $11,990 respectively.
This year’s “Schools Highly Focused on Criminology Major in New Mexico” ranking analyzed 2 colleges that offered a degree in criminology. This a ranking of the schools where the largest percentage of students has enrolled in criminology.
